About iShares U.S. Regional Banks ETF (NYSEARCA:IAT) The iShares U.S. Regional Banks ETF (IAT)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the DJ US Select \u002F Regional Banks index. The fund tracks the performance of an index of small- and mid-cap regional banks. IAT was launched on May 1, 2006 and is managed by BlackRock.Mar 12, 2023 · The iShares U.S. Regional Banks ETF provides targeted exposure to the U.S. regional bank sector. The ETF has $578 million in assets and charges a 0.39% expense ratio. Portfolio Holdings.
